溫馨提示×

centos如何解決jellyfin卡頓問題

小樊
52
2025-04-30 20:25:20
欄目: 智能運維

Jellyfin在CentOS上卡頓可能是由于多種原因造成的,包括硬件資源不足、軟件配置不當、網絡問題等。以下是一些可能的解決方案:

硬件優化

  • 增加內存:如果服務器內存不足,考慮增加物理內存。
  • 使用SSD:將系統盤和媒體文件存儲更換為SSD,以提高讀寫速度。
  • 升級CPU:如果服務器CPU性能較低,考慮升級到更快的型號。
  • 啟用硬件加速:如果服務器支持,啟用Jellyfin的硬件加速功能,如Intel Quick Sync或NVIDIA CUDA。

軟件優化

  • 調整內存限制:通過修改Jellyfin的systemd服務文件,增加或減少分配給Jellyfin的內存。
  • 啟用并配置緩存:在Jellyfin的配置文件中啟用緩存,并適當調整緩存大小。
  • 限制并發連接數:調整配置文件中的MaxConcurrentSessions設置,減少同時連接到服務器的客戶端數量。
  • 選擇合適的視頻編碼:使用高效的編碼格式,如H.265,以減少視頻文件大小同時保持良好的播放質量。
  • 網絡設置優化:確保服務器的網絡設置合理,避免帶寬浪費和不必要的數據傳輸。

其他優化措施

  • 使用Docker:如果尚未使用,可以考慮使用Docker來部署Jellyfin,因為Docker可以提供更一致的運行環境和更簡單的部署流程。
  • 更新Jellyfin和依賴庫:確保Jellyfin及其依賴庫都是最新版本,以獲得性能改進和bug修復。

故障排查

  • 檢查日志文件:Jellyfin的日志文件通常位于 /var/log/jellyfin/ 目錄下。檢查這些日志文件可以找到錯誤消息和警告,幫助你定位問題。
  • 確認網絡連接:使用 ping 命令測試與遠程主機之間的連通性。如果無法ping通目標主機,則可能存在網絡故障。
  • 檢查依賴和服務:確保所有必要的依賴包已安裝。例如,Jellyfin需要 ffmpeg 進行轉碼,可以使用以下命令安裝:yum install ffmpeg。
  • 配置文件檢查:檢查Jellyfin的配置文件,確保媒體庫路徑設置正確,且所有必要的插件和依賴都已正確安裝。

在進行任何系統級更改之前,建議先備份重要數據,以防萬一。如果您在優化后仍然遇到卡頓問題,可能需要進一步檢查服務器的具體配置和使用情況,或者考慮升級硬件。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女